Easy Vanilla Buttercream Frosting

Ingredients
- 1 cup unsalted butter, room temperature
- 4 cups powdered sugar
- 2-4 tablespoons heavy whipping cream
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of kosher salt
Directions
- Place the butter in the bowl of a stand mixer, or use a large mixing bowl with a hand mixer, and beat it until it’s smooth and creamy.
- Add 2 cups of powdered sugar and 1 tablespoon of heavy cream. Mix on low until the sugar has worked its way into the butter, then scrape the bowl. Increase the mixer to high and beat for 1 minute. Scrape the bowl again, then do the same thing with the remaining 2 cups of powdered sugar and another 1 tablespoon of cream.
- Add the vanilla and salt, and beat until everything is combined. If the frosting feels too firm, mix in an additional 1-2 tablespoons of cream at a time. You’re looking for buttercream that can hold a peak, but still spreads easily.
